N2 - Using (27.12±0.14)×108 ψ(2S) events collected by the BESIII detector operating at BEPCII, we search for the decay ηc(2S)→pp¯ via the process ψ(2S)→γηc(2S) and only find a signal with a significance of 1.7σ. The upper limit of the product branching fraction at the 90% confidence level is determined to be B(ψ(2S)→γηc(2S))×B(ηc(2S)→pp¯)
